- The distance between Nuuk/ Godthåb, Greenland and Nzerekore, Guinea is approximately 7,142 km or 4,438 mi.
- To reach Nuuk/ Godthåb in this distance one would set out from Nzerekore bearing 340.6°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Nuuk/ Godthåb bearing 310.8° or NW .
- Nuuk/ Godthåb has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Nzerekore has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Nuuk/ Godthåb is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ome whereas Nzerekore is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 25.8 °C (46.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12 °C (21.6°F) more in Nuuk/ Godthåb.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 998 mm (39.3 in) less which is equivalent to 998 l/m² (24.49 US gal/ft²) or 9,980,000 l/ha (1,066,928 US gal/ac) less. About 3/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 48.2° lower in Nuuk/ Godthåb than in Nzerekore.
- Relative humidity levels are 4.3%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 24°C (43.2°F) lower.
